<?php
/**
* Copyright (c) Microsoft Corporation. All Rights Reserved. Licensed under the MIT License. See License in the project root for license information.
*
* MacOSCompliancePolicy File
* PHP version 7
*
* @category Library
* @package Microsoft.Graph
* @copyright (c) Microsoft Corporation. All rights reserved.
* @license https://opensource.org/licenses/MIT MIT License
* @link https://graph.microsoft.com
*/
namespace Microsoft\Graph\Model;
/**
* MacOSCompliancePolicy class
*
* @category Model
* @package Microsoft.Graph
* @copyright (c) Microsoft Corporation. All rights reserved.
* @license https://opensource.org/licenses/MIT MIT License
* @link https://graph.microsoft.com
*/
class MacOSCompliancePolicy extends DeviceCompliancePolicy
{
/**
* Gets the deviceThreatProtectionEnabled
* Require that devices have enabled device threat protection.
*
* @return bool|null The deviceThreatProtectionEnabled
*/
public function getDeviceThreatProtectionEnabled()
{
if (array_key_exists("deviceThreatProtectionEnabled", $this->_propDict)) {
return $this->_propDict["deviceThreatProtectionEnabled"];
} else {
return null;
}
}
/**
* Sets the deviceThreatProtectionEnabled
* Require that devices have enabled device threat protection.
*
* @param bool $val The deviceThreatProtectionEnabled
*
* @return MacOSCompliancePolicy
*/
public function setDeviceThreatProtectionEnabled($val)
{
$this->_propDict["deviceThreatProtectionEnabled"] = boolval($val);
return $this;
}
/**
* Gets the deviceThreatProtectionRequiredSecurityLevel
* Require Mobile Threat Protection minimum risk level to report noncompliance. Possible values are: unavailable, secured, low, medium, high, notSet.
*
* @return DeviceThreatProtectionLevel|null The deviceThreatProtectionRequiredSecurityLevel
*/
public function getDeviceThreatProtectionRequiredSecurityLevel()
{
if (array_key_exists("deviceThreatProtectionRequiredSecurityLevel", $this->_propDict)) {
if (is_a($this->_propDict["deviceThreatProtectionRequiredSecurityLevel"], "\Microsoft\Graph\Model\DeviceThreatProtectionLevel") || is_null($this->_propDict["deviceThreatProtectionRequiredSecurityLevel"])) {
return $this->_propDict["deviceThreatProtectionRequiredSecurityLevel"];
} else {
$this->_propDict["deviceThreatProtectionRequiredSecurityLevel"] = new DeviceThreatProtectionLevel($this->_propDict["deviceThreatProtectionRequiredSecurityLevel"]);
return $this->_propDict["deviceThreatProtectionRequiredSecurityLevel"];
}
}
return null;
}
/**
* Sets the deviceThreatProtectionRequiredSecurityLevel
* Require Mobile Threat Protection minimum risk level to report noncompliance. Possible values are: unavailable, secured, low, medium, high, notSet.
*
* @param DeviceThreatProtectionLevel $val The deviceThreatProtectionRequiredSecurityLevel
*
* @return MacOSCompliancePolicy
*/
public function setDeviceThreatProtectionRequiredSecurityLevel($val)
{
$this->_propDict["deviceThreatProtectionRequiredSecurityLevel"] = $val;
return $this;
}
/**
* Gets the firewallBlockAllIncoming
* Corresponds to the 'Block all incoming connections' option.
*
* @return bool|null The firewallBlockAllIncoming
*/
public function getFirewallBlockAllIncoming()
{
if (array_key_exists("firewallBlockAllIncoming", $this->_propDict)) {
return $this->_propDict["firewallBlockAllIncoming"];
} else {
return null;
}
}
/**
* Sets the firewallBlockAllIncoming
* Corresponds to the 'Block all incoming connections' option.
*
* @param bool $val The firewallBlockAllIncoming
*
* @return MacOSCompliancePolicy
*/
public function setFirewallBlockAllIncoming($val)
{
$this->_propDict["firewallBlockAllIncoming"] = boolval($val);
return $this;
}
/**
* Gets the firewallEnabled
* Whether the firewall should be enabled or not.
*
* @return bool|null The firewallEnabled
*/
public function getFirewallEnabled()
{
if (array_key_exists("firewallEnabled", $this->_propDict)) {
return $this->_propDict["firewallEnabled"];
} else {
return null;
}
}
/**
* Sets the firewallEnabled
* Whether the firewall should be enabled or not.
*
* @param bool $val The firewallEnabled
*
* @return MacOSCompliancePolicy
*/
public function setFirewallEnabled($val)
{
$this->_propDict["firewallEnabled"] = boolval($val);
return $this;
}
/**
* Gets the firewallEnableStealthMode
* Corresponds to 'Enable stealth mode.'
*
* @return bool|null The firewallEnableStealthMode
*/
public function getFirewallEnableStealthMode()
{
if (array_key_exists("firewallEnableStealthMode", $this->_propDict)) {
return $this->_propDict["firewallEnableStealthMode"];
} else {
return null;
}
}
/**
* Sets the firewallEnableStealthMode
* Corresponds to 'Enable stealth mode.'
*
* @param bool $val The firewallEnableStealthMode
*
* @return MacOSCompliancePolicy
*/
public function setFirewallEnableStealthMode($val)
{
$this->_propDict["firewallEnableStealthMode"] = boolval($val);
return $this;
}
/**
* Gets the osMaximumVersion
* Maximum MacOS version.
*
* @return string|null The osMaximumVersion
*/
public function getOsMaximumVersion()
{
if (array_key_exists("osMaximumVersion", $this->_propDict)) {
return $this->_propDict["osMaximumVersion"];
} else {
return null;
}
}
/**
* Sets the osMaximumVersion
* Maximum MacOS version.
*
* @param string $val The osMaximumVersion
*
* @return MacOSCompliancePolicy
*/
public function setOsMaximumVersion($val)
{
$this->_propDict["osMaximumVersion"] = $val;
return $this;
}
/**
* Gets the osMinimumVersion
* Minimum MacOS version.
*
* @return string|null The osMinimumVersion
*/
public function getOsMinimumVersion()
{
if (array_key_exists("osMinimumVersion", $this->_propDict)) {
return $this->_propDict["osMinimumVersion"];
} else {
return null;
}
}
/**
* Sets the osMinimumVersion
* Minimum MacOS version.
*
* @param string $val The osMinimumVersion
*
* @return MacOSCompliancePolicy
*/
public function setOsMinimumVersion($val)
{
$this->_propDict["osMinimumVersion"] = $val;
return $this;
}
/**
* Gets the passwordBlockSimple
* Indicates whether or not to block simple passwords.
*
* @return bool|null The passwordBlockSimple
*/
public function getPasswordBlockSimple()
{
if (array_key_exists("passwordBlockSimple", $this->_propDict)) {
return $this->_propDict["passwordBlockSimple"];
} else {
return null;
}
}
/**
* Sets the passwordBlockSimple
* Indicates whether or not to block simple passwords.
*
* @param bool $val The passwordBlockSimple
*
* @return MacOSCompliancePolicy
*/
public function setPasswordBlockSimple($val)
{
$this->_propDict["passwordBlockSimple"] = boolval($val);
return $this;
}
/**
* Gets the passwordExpirationDays
* Number of days before the password expires. Valid values 1 to 65535
*
* @return int|null The passwordExpirationDays
*/
public function getPasswordExpirationDays()
{
if (array_key_exists("passwordExpirationDays", $this->_propDict)) {
return $this->_propDict["passwordExpirationDays"];
} else {
return null;
}
}
/**
* Sets the passwordExpirationDays
* Number of days before the password expires. Valid values 1 to 65535
*
* @param int $val The passwordExpirationDays
*
* @return MacOSCompliancePolicy
*/
public function setPasswordExpirationDays($val)
{
$this->_propDict["passwordExpirationDays"] = intval($val);
return $this;
}
/**
* Gets the passwordMinimumCharacterSetCount
* The number of character sets required in the password.
*
* @return int|null The passwordMinimumCharacterSetCount
*/
public function getPasswordMinimumCharacterSetCount()
{
if (array_key_exists("passwordMinimumCharacterSetCount", $this->_propDict)) {
return $this->_propDict["passwordMinimumCharacterSetCount"];
} else {
return null;
}
}
/**
* Sets the passwordMinimumCharacterSetCount
* The number of character sets required in the password.
*
* @param int $val The passwordMinimumCharacterSetCount
*
* @return MacOSCompliancePolicy
*/
public function setPasswordMinimumCharacterSetCount($val)
{
$this->_propDict["passwordMinimumCharacterSetCount"] = intval($val);
return $this;
}
/**
* Gets the passwordMinimumLength
* Minimum length of password. Valid values 4 to 14
*
* @return int|null The passwordMinimumLength
*/
public function getPasswordMinimumLength()
{
if (array_key_exists("passwordMinimumLength", $this->_propDict)) {
return $this->_propDict["passwordMinimumLength"];
} else {
return null;
}
}
/**
* Sets the passwordMinimumLength
* Minimum length of password. Valid values 4 to 14
*
* @param int $val The passwordMinimumLength
*
* @return MacOSCompliancePolicy
*/
public function setPasswordMinimumLength($val)
{
$this->_propDict["passwordMinimumLength"] = intval($val);
return $this;
}
/**
* Gets the passwordMinutesOfInactivityBeforeLock
* Minutes of inactivity before a password is required.
*
* @return int|null The passwordMinutesOfInactivityBeforeLock
*/
public function getPasswordMinutesOfInactivityBeforeLock()
{
if (array_key_exists("passwordMinutesOfInactivityBeforeLock", $this->_propDict)) {
return $this->_propDict["passwordMinutesOfInactivityBeforeLock"];
} else {
return null;
}
}
/**
* Sets the passwordMinutesOfInactivityBeforeLock
* Minutes of inactivity before a password is required.
*
* @param int $val The passwordMinutesOfInactivityBeforeLock
*
* @return MacOSCompliancePolicy
*/
public function setPasswordMinutesOfInactivityBeforeLock($val)
{
$this->_propDict["passwordMinutesOfInactivityBeforeLock"] = intval($val);
return $this;
}
/**
* Gets the passwordPreviousPasswordBlockCount
* Number of previous passwords to block. Valid values 1 to 24
*
* @return int|null The passwordPreviousPasswordBlockCount
*/
public function getPasswordPreviousPasswordBlockCount()
{
if (array_key_exists("passwordPreviousPasswordBlockCount", $this->_propDict)) {
return $this->_propDict["passwordPreviousPasswordBlockCount"];
} else {
return null;
}
}
/**
* Sets the passwordPreviousPasswordBlockCount
* Number of previous passwords to block. Valid values 1 to 24
*
* @param int $val The passwordPreviousPasswordBlockCount
*
* @return MacOSCompliancePolicy
*/
public function setPasswordPreviousPasswordBlockCount($val)
{
$this->_propDict["passwordPreviousPasswordBlockCount"] = intval($val);
return $this;
}
/**
* Gets the passwordRequired
* Whether or not to require a password.
*
* @return bool|null The passwordRequired
*/
public function getPasswordRequired()
{
if (array_key_exists("passwordRequired", $this->_propDict)) {
return $this->_propDict["passwordRequired"];
} else {
return null;
}
}
/**
* Sets the passwordRequired
* Whether or not to require a password.
*
* @param bool $val The passwordRequired
*
* @return MacOSCompliancePolicy
*/
public function setPasswordRequired($val)
{
$this->_propDict["passwordRequired"] = boolval($val);
return $this;
}
/**
* Gets the passwordRequiredType
* The required password type. Possible values are: deviceDefault, alphanumeric, numeric.
*
* @return RequiredPasswordType|null The passwordRequiredType
*/
public function getPasswordRequiredType()
{
if (array_key_exists("passwordRequiredType", $this->_propDict)) {
if (is_a($this->_propDict["passwordRequiredType"], "\Microsoft\Graph\Model\RequiredPasswordType") || is_null($this->_propDict["passwordRequiredType"])) {
return $this->_propDict["passwordRequiredType"];
} else {
$this->_propDict["passwordRequiredType"] = new RequiredPasswordType($this->_propDict["passwordRequiredType"]);
return $this->_propDict["passwordRequiredType"];
}
}
return null;
}
/**
* Sets the passwordRequiredType
* The required password type. Possible values are: deviceDefault, alphanumeric, numeric.
*
* @param RequiredPasswordType $val The passwordRequiredType
*
* @return MacOSCompliancePolicy
*/
public function setPasswordRequiredType($val)
{
$this->_propDict["passwordRequiredType"] = $val;
return $this;
}
/**
* Gets the storageRequireEncryption
* Require encryption on Mac OS devices.
*
* @return bool|null The storageRequireEncryption
*/
public function getStorageRequireEncryption()
{
if (array_key_exists("storageRequireEncryption", $this->_propDict)) {
return $this->_propDict["storageRequireEncryption"];
} else {
return null;
}
}
/**
* Sets the storageRequireEncryption
* Require encryption on Mac OS devices.
*
* @param bool $val The storageRequireEncryption
*
* @return MacOSCompliancePolicy
*/
public function setStorageRequireEncryption($val)
{
$this->_propDict["storageRequireEncryption"] = boolval($val);
return $this;
}
/**
* Gets the systemIntegrityProtectionEnabled
* Require that devices have enabled system integrity protection.
*
* @return bool|null The systemIntegrityProtectionEnabled
*/
public function getSystemIntegrityProtectionEnabled()
{
if (array_key_exists("systemIntegrityProtectionEnabled", $this->_propDict)) {
return $this->_propDict["systemIntegrityProtectionEnabled"];
} else {
return null;
}
}
/**
* Sets the systemIntegrityProtectionEnabled
* Require that devices have enabled system integrity protection.
*
* @param bool $val The systemIntegrityProtectionEnabled
*
* @return MacOSCompliancePolicy
*/
public function setSystemIntegrityProtectionEnabled($val)
{
$this->_propDict["systemIntegrityProtectionEnabled"] = boolval($val);
return $this;
}
}
